Gustav Mahler

-born July 7, 1860, Kalischt,
Bohemia(then Austria, now
the Czech Republic)

-died May 18, 1911, Vienna,
Austria

3

media

A composer of the Romantic Era

-As a child, Gustav Mahler took piano lessons and showed a great interest
in music.

- His parents took him to the Vienna Conservatory of music, where he was
accepted for study at age fifteen.

-He also studied history and philosophy at the University of Vienna.

-While at the conservatory from 1875 through 1878, Gustav wrote his first
musical compositions.

-He began work on his first symphony in 1880.

Career as a Conductor

-Throughout the early 1880s, he took a variety of jobs as orchestra
conductor in towns and small cities in Austria, Slovenia, Bohemia, and
Germany.

-In 1885 Mahler was named assistant conductor of the Prague
(Czechoslovakia) Opera, and in 1886 became assistant conductor of the
Leipzig (Germany) Opera.

-He later held the position of music director of the Budapest Royal Opera
(1888) and conductor of the Hamburg Opera (1891).

8

media

Career cont.

-Mahler had established himself as one of the premier orchestral and
opera conductors in central Europe.

-He did most of his composing in the summers, when his orchestras and
operas were not performing. In 1897, Mahler became music director of
the Vienna State Opera, a very important position.

- A year later he also took on the position of conductor of the Vienna
Philharmonic. Undoubtedly, Mahler was now the most important musical
figure in Austria.

Mahler’s Summers

-Mahler purchased a summer home near a lake in the Austrian
countryside. He used this home as a retreat where he worked on his
music.

-wrote four symphonies here between 1901 and 1907. Mahler was now
composing orchestral music almost exclusively, although some of his
symphonies called for singers in addition to a full orchestra.

-Settled into a productive professional life as a composer and conductor.
However, after several years with the Vienna Philharmonic and the Vienna
State Opera, disagreements with both organizations caused him to resign

Mahler in the USA

-Mahler moved to the United States in 1907 and was named conductor of
the Metropolitan Opera.

-In 1909 (age forty-nine), he added the position of conductor of the New
York Philharmonic. Mahler held these positions until 1911, although he
continued to spend his summers in Europe.

-Once again, disagreements and conflicts with his employers caused him
to resign.

-In 1911 he returned to Vienna, where he died of a heart attack in May.

13

media

Mahler as a person

-As a conductor, Gustav Mahler was always well received by audiences and
music critics. The same cannot be said of his music.

-During his lifetime, Mahler’s symphonies were often considered to be too
long, too loud, and too complex.

-His music fell into disfavor after his death, but were revived later in the
twentieth century.

-Although some of his symphonies were written in the early twentieth
century, Mahler is considered the last great composer of the Romantic
era.
